In this candid conversation, Marie sits down with Vee Weir—the force behind @VeeFrugalFox and Weir Digital Marketing—to talk about the real work of money, business, and becoming yourself. Vee shares her path from debt to financial freedom, why money is a neutral tool, and how privilege, identity, and policy shape personal finance outcomes. We also get practical: when to leave a 9–5, how to build a purpose-driven brand, what to post first, and the non-negotiables every new founder needs (CPA, separate accounts, consistent content).Expect straight talk on conscious wealth, empathy-based budgeting, building connection online, and showing up as your whole self—without waiting for permission.Guest: Vee Weir — CEO, Weir Digital Marketing; creator of @VeeFrugalFox; personal finance educatorThemes: debt payoff, entrepreneurship, privilege & money, conscious wealth, identity & faith (Wicca), content strategy, authenticity, safety & maskingLight content note: mentions of divorce, domestic violence, and sexual assault (non-graphic).Guest LinksInstagram: @VeeFrugalFoxWebsite: veefrugalfox.comAgency: Weir Digital MarketingKey TakeawaysMoney is a tool, not a moral scorecard. It amplifies intention. Aim it at freedom, time, options, contribution.Context matters. Personal finance sits inside policy, privilege, identity, and systemic realities—address both the micro and macro.Empathy-based budgeting works. Grace, honesty, and intention beat shame and rigidity over the long term.Relationships are your moat. Connection > algorithms. Vee’s business was built on years of genuine community.Start before you’re ready. “Imperfect action beats perfect inaction.” Publish consistently; refine in public.Founder non-negotiables: get a CPA, create separate business accounts, formalize your entity/LLC, and start posting.Mission > me. Your content should answer: What problem do I solve? How do I make life better for my audience?Resources mentioned:Empathy-based budgeting (Vee’s framework)Starter founder checklist (CPA, entity, accounts, content plan)Content ideas: 5 posts to publish first (problem → promise, origin story, quick win tutorial, FAQs, client mini-case)If you’re starting now:Write your mission in one sentence (who you serve + the result).Open separate biz accounts and book a CPA consult.Publish 3–5 posts this week tied to your mission (teach one tiny win).
